Is it safe to be with my husband after he had his anthrax vaccine?

2 doctors weighed in across 2 answers
Dr. Heidi Fowler answered

Specializes in Psychiatry

Yes - it is safe.: In the us the anthrax vaccine for humans is acellular. Although about 1% of people have a significant reaction it is not transmittable/communicable.
